How Investment Trends Are Shaping the Future Size of the Gold Market
The global gold market continues to play a central role in shaping financial stability and investment patterns across continents. The size of the gold market is expanding due to a combination of economic uncertainty, industrial innovation, and technological integration. As currencies fluctuate and geopolitical risks rise, gold remains a cornerstone for diversification and long-term wealth preservation. From jewelry to investment funds, its appeal transcends age and geography.
Over recent years, the world has seen a surge in digital trading platforms that allow users to invest in fractional gold. This new accessibility has broadened participation, leading to increased liquidity and price stability. Additionally, institutional investors are once again strengthening their portfolios with gold assets, especially during periods of stock market volatility. Governments, too, have ramped up their gold reserves to reduce dependency on fiat currencies. All these forces collectively contribute to the continued expansion of the size of the gold market.
Industrial and technological uses of gold are rising rapidly. The metal’s unparalleled conductivity, durability, and resistance to corrosion make it indispensable for electronics, aerospace, and renewable energy systems. Moreover, its applications in healthcare and nanotechnology are creating new avenues for demand. Ethical sourcing and recycling have become vital topics, promoting sustainability within the industry.
